Rooms and Ameneties at Sundara Mahal Homestay

Sundara Mahal was designed for a joint family. There is adequate space ensuring no one feels crowded.

The common rooms all have high ceilings and glass windows that provide air circulation and light.

There have been no structural changes through these generations but every effort is taken to maintain them in excellent condition.

Through conscious power management and energy efficient lighting we try to and our aim is, to get off the grid and move totally to alternate sustainable power sources.

Sundara Mahal offers our guests, at any given time, Two exclusive rooms for their stay thus ensuring privacy.

Each room is furnished with spring mattresses in King sized 7’x7’ cots and if needed extra beds are provided.

Toilets have tiled walls and floors, hot and cold water mixers, washbasin, mirrors, clean toilet seats, toilet paper and health faucets.

There is a writer’s corner in each room with writing table, lamp, Designer Chairs that make ergonomic sense and an earthed power socket for Laptops. The rooms have Belgian Mirrors, Comfortable recliners, Coffee Tables, cupboards, adequate and tasteful lighting, Fan and Insect proof netting, clean fresh linen and blankets. Blankets? Yes! Through the cool micro climate of the wooded property, nature provides the air-conditioning, 24 x 365.
